TimescaleDB是一個開源的時間序列數據庫,建立在PostgreSQL之上,專門用于處理大規模的時間序列數據。以下是一些適用場景: 1. 物聯網(IoT)應用:TimescaleDB非常適合存...
TimescaleDB是一個開源的關系數據庫擴展,專門用于處理時間序列數據。它在PostgreSQL之上構建,利用了PostgreSQL的強大功能和性能,同時為時間序列數據提供了額外的優化和擴展功能。...
在PostgreSQL中使用TimescaleDB時,可以采取以下措施來解決安全性問題: 1. 數據加密:TimescaleDB支持SSL/TLS加密來保護數據在傳輸過程中的安全性。可以配置數據庫服...
在TimescaleDB中,可以使用以下方法來監控數據庫性能: 1. pg_stat_statements:這個擴展模塊可以跟蹤SQL查詢的性能指標,包括查詢執行時間、掃描行數、命中緩存等。 2....
在TimescaleDB中,數據備份和恢復的方法可以分為兩種:物理備份和邏輯備份。 1. 物理備份: 可以使用pg_dump和pg_restore進行物理備份和恢復。 - 備份:使用pg_dump命...
在PostgreSQL中,TimescaleDB提供了以下幾種分區方法: 1. 時間分區(Time Partitioning):按照時間范圍來分割數據,通常是按照時間戳來進行分區,如按天、按月、按年...
在PostgreSQL中,可以通過以下方法來遷移數據到TimescaleDB: 1. 使用COPY命令:可以使用COPY命令將數據從現有的表中導出,然后再將數據導入到TimescaleDB中的新表中...
TimescaleDB是一個用于處理時序數據的開源擴展插件,基于PostgreSQL構建,旨在提供高性能和可伸縮性的解決方案。以下是一些優化TimescaleDB性能的方法: 1. 分區表:使用分區...
1. 使用超級用戶權限進行安裝:在安裝和配置TimescaleDB時,建議使用超級用戶權限。可以使用CREATE EXTENSION命令來安裝TimescaleDB。 2. 使用分區表:Timesc...
在安裝TimescaleDB之前,需要先安裝PostgreSQL。安裝PostgreSQL和TimescaleDB的方法可以分為以下幾種: 1. 使用TimescaleDB官方提供的安裝腳本:Tim...